Supporting the Success of PEKSIMINAS XVIII 2026: FMIPA UNEJ to Host the Playwriting Competition Category

Universitas Jember is hosting the Pekan Seni Mahasiswa Nasional (PEKSIMINAS) XVIII in 2026, taking place from September 7 to 11, 2026. This national event brings together top talent from 34 provinces to compete across 15 competition categories. The theme for PEKSIMINAS 2026 is “PEKSIMINAS Bergerak, Seni Berdampak” PEKSIMINAS is a recurring event organized by the Directorate of Learning and Student Affairs (Directorate General of Higher Education, Ministry of Higher Education, Science, and Technology) in collaboration with the Badan Pembina Seni Mahasiswa Indonesia (BPSMI). The FMIPA UNEJ has been entrusted to host the Playwriting competition category.

The series of activities began with a technical meeting on September 8, 2026, led directly by the three-member panel of judges. This meeting served as a forum to align understanding regarding competition mechanics, rules, and judging criteria, ensuring all participants shared a common understanding before the competition commenced. Participants and accompanying personnel had the opportunity to interact with the judges and the organizing committee to ensure the event would be conducted in an orderly and professional manner. The first day concluded with a site visit to BIN CIGAR Jember, a manufacturer of premium handmade cigars.

The Playwriting Competition took place on September 9, 2026, at the International Class of the Mathematics Department, Faculty of Mathematics and Natural Sciences (FMIPA), University of Jember. The event ran from 08:00 to 16:00 WIB, featuring 24 provincial representatives participating in person and one participant joining online from the Special Region of Aceh due to force majeure. Throughout the competition, participants demonstrated their best abilities by crafting creative, original scripts rich in artistic value, adhering to the specific theme set by the jury at the start of the event. The competition results will be announced during the closing and awards ceremony of PEKSIMINAS XVIII 2026 on the following day, September 10, 2026.
